logo

Output 62d17828143ebf88a1ad2091f378f7c0f19e11507bc3322e8528d5e7381c8b38:1

value
39000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0714b9beedcd2041233790ef6376a8774f7cb765 OP_EQUALVERIFY OP_CHECKSIG
address
1eSZP5TErKvueXJ5Jqxj62fb6YCXLogNq
transaction
62d17828143ebf88a1ad2091f378f7c0f19e11507bc3322e8528d5e7381c8b38